"""The `sql` connector (ingest-spec §4, §8). sqlite via connection_ref env-var resolution (the ref names the variable; its value is the database path), read-only open, single statement, streaming max_rows cap, typed errors for every sqlite failure. """ from __future__ import annotations import sqlite3 from pathlib import Path import pytest from llm_ingestion_okf.connectors import read_sql from llm_ingestion_okf.errors import IngestError, SourceError REF = "OKF_TEST_DB" @pytest.fixture def db_path(tmp_path: Path, monkeypatch: pytest.MonkeyPatch) -> Path: path = tmp_path / "fixture.db" with sqlite3.connect(path) as conn: conn.execute("CREATE TABLE t (id INTEGER, name TEXT, score REAL, note TEXT)") conn.executemany( "INSERT INTO t VALUES (?, ?, ?, ?)", [(1, "alpha", 1.5, None), (2, "beta", 0.1, "x|y")], ) monkeypatch.setenv(REF, str(path)) return path # --- happy path: §5 text form, source order --- def test_reads_header_and_rows_as_text(db_path: Path) -> None: header, rows = read_sql(REF, "SELECT id, name, score, note FROM t ORDER BY id", max_rows=10) assert header == ["id", "name", "score", "note"] # NULL -> empty string; int plain decimal; float shortest round-trip; text verbatim. assert rows == [["1", "alpha", "1.5", ""], ["2", "beta", "0.1", "x|y"]] # --- env-var resolution (credentials never in the manifest, §4) --- def test_unset_connection_ref_rejected(monkeypatch: pytest.MonkeyPatch) -> None: monkeypatch.delenv(REF, raising=False) with pytest.raises(SourceError): read_sql(REF, "SELECT 1", max_rows=10) def test_empty_connection_ref_rejected(monkeypatch: pytest.MonkeyPatch) -> None: monkeypatch.setenv(REF, "") with pytest.raises(SourceError): read_sql(REF, "SELECT 1", max_rows=10) def test_missing_database_file_rejected(tmp_path: Path, monkeypatch: pytest.MonkeyPatch) -> None: monkeypatch.setenv(REF, str(tmp_path / "nope.db")) with pytest.raises(SourceError): read_sql(REF, "SELECT 1", max_rows=10) # --- read-only, single statement, typed sqlite errors --- def test_write_statement_fails_at_the_database(db_path: Path) -> None: """Read-only is enforced by the connection mode, not string parsing.""" with pytest.raises(SourceError): read_sql(REF, "DELETE FROM t", max_rows=10) def test_multiple_statements_rejected(db_path: Path) -> None: with pytest.raises(SourceError): read_sql(REF, "SELECT 1; SELECT 2", max_rows=10) def test_syntax_error_wrapped_in_typed_error(db_path: Path) -> None: with pytest.raises(SourceError): read_sql(REF, "SELEC nonsense", max_rows=10) def test_blob_cell_fails_typed(db_path: Path, tmp_path: Path) -> None: """Never silent coercion (§5): a BLOB cell is a typed IngestError.""" with sqlite3.connect(tmp_path / "fixture.db") as conn: conn.execute("INSERT INTO t VALUES (3, 'blob', 0.0, x'DEADBEEF')") with pytest.raises(IngestError): read_sql(REF, "SELECT note FROM t WHERE id = 3", max_rows=10) # --- max_rows cap (§8): error, never silent truncation --- def test_row_count_at_cap_is_allowed(db_path: Path) -> None: _, rows = read_sql(REF, "SELECT id FROM t ORDER BY id", max_rows=2) assert len(rows) == 2 def test_exceeding_cap_is_an_error(db_path: Path) -> None: with pytest.raises(SourceError): read_sql(REF, "SELECT id FROM t ORDER BY id", max_rows=1)
